HTML BODY {
	MARGIN:0px;  PADDING:0px; TEXT-ALIGN:left; FONT-SIZE:13px; FONT-FAMILY:"Arial","Microsoft YaHei";color:#525353;
}
TD,div {font-family: "Arial","Microsoft YaHei";font-size: 13px; color: #333333; line-height:22px;}

INPUT,TEXTAREA {BORDER-WIDTH:1px; BORDER-COLOR:cccccc;background:ffffff;font-family: "Arial","Microsoft YaHei";}
INPUT{ outline:medium;}
img{ border:0}
*{ margin:0}
a{ text-decoration:none; color:#333}
a:hover{}
ul{ padding:0; margin:0}
li{ list-style:none;}
.clear{clear:both; overflow:hidden; height:0px;}


@font-face {
    font-family: 'helvetica_italic';
    src: url('helvetica_condensed_italic.woff2') format('woff2'),
         url('helvetica_condensed_italic.woff') format('woff');
    font-weight: normal;
    font-style: normal;

}
@font-face {
    font-family: 'helvetica_condensed';
    src: url('helvetica_condensed.woff2') format('woff2'),
         url('helvetica_condensed.woff') format('woff');
    font-weight: normal;
    font-style: normal;

}

#animate1,#animate2,#animate3,#animate4,#animate4_1,#animate4_2,#animate5,#animate6,#animate6_1,#animate6_2,#animate7,#animate7-1,#animate8,#animate8_1,#animate8_2,#animate9,#animate9-1,#animate9-2,#animate10,#animate10-1,#animate11,#animate11-1,#animate_banner {
	-webkit-backface-visibility: hidden;
	-moz-backface-visibility: hidden;
	-ms-backface-visibility: hidden;
	backface-visibility: hidden;
	
	-webkit-animation-duration: 1s;
	-webkit-animation-delay: .2s;
	-webkit-animation-timing-function: ease;
	-webkit-animation-fill-mode: both;
	-moz-animation-duration: 1s;
	-moz-animation-delay: .2s;
	-moz-animation-timing-function: ease;
	-moz-animation-fill-mode: both;
	-ms-animation-duration: 1s;
	-ms-animation-delay: .2s;
	-ms-animation-timing-function: ease;
	-ms-animation-fill-mode: both;
	animation-duration: 1s;
	animation-delay: .2s;
	animation-timing-function: ease;
	animation-fill-mode: both;
}
#at4-share{display: none;}
.top_headbg{min-width:1190px; max-width:1920px; margin:0 auto; height:43px; background:#333333;}
.top_head{width:1190px; margin:auto; height:43px;}
.top_head ul li{ float:left; font-size:13px; color:#ffffff; line-height:43px;}
.top_head ul li a{font-size:13px; color:#ffffff;}
/*logo*/

.menuon{display:block;}
.menuon h2{ font-size:14px; color:#0b72a9 !important; font-weight:normal; line-height:58px;}

.in_banner{ width:100%; margin:0 auto; min-width:1190px; max-width:1920px; height:301px;}

/*面包屑导航*/


.index_bottom_friendlink{margin-top:10px;margin-bottom:30px;width:350px;float: left;}
.index_bottom_friendlink a{font-size: 16px;color: #419019;margin-left:8px;text-decoration:underline;}


.r_mbx{float: right;padding-left: 25px;margin-right: 10px;margin-bottom:30px;margin-top:10px; height:31px; text-align:left; line-height:31px; font-size:14px; color:#8e8d8d;background:url(../img/in_home.png) left 4px no-repeat;}
.r_mbx a{font-size:14px; color:#8e8d8d;}
.page_RightTitle{width:900px;}
.page_RightTitle {line-height: 25px;font-size: 20px; color: #000;text-transform: uppercase;text-align: left;height: 30px;padding-bottom:15px;
background:url(../img/right_title.png) bottom no-repeat;
}
.page_RightTitle span{color: #419019}

.page_RightTitle2{width:900px;}
.page_RightTitle2 {line-height: 35px;font-size: 18px; color: #419019;text-transform: uppercase;text-align: left;height: 30px;padding-bottom:15px;
background:url(../img/right_title.png) bottom no-repeat;
}
.page_RightTitle2 span{color: #419019}



.in_RightTitle{width:1190px; margin:auto; margin-top:34px; background:url(../img/index_line.jpg) center no-repeat; text-align:center; line-height:45px; font-size:34px; color:#333333; font-weight:bold;}
.in_RightTitle span{ background:#FFFFFF; padding:0 15px;}
.page_Main{ width:900px;float: right;} 

/*内页左侧*/

.page_LeftClass{width:280px;float: left;margin-bottom: 30px;}
.page_LeftClass ul li{float:left;}
.parent{float:left; padding:10px 20px 10px 17px; text-align:center;}
.parent h3{font-size:16px; color:#000000; line-height:24px; font-weight:normal;}
.parent:hover{ background:url(../img/left_dot1.jpg) left no-repeat;}
.parent a:hover{ text-decoration:none;}
.parent1{float:left; padding:10px 20px 10px 17px; background:url(../img/left_dot1.jpg) left no-repeat; text-align:center;}
.parent1 h3{font-size:16px; color:#000000; line-height:24px; font-weight:normal;}
.parent1 a:hover{ text-decoration:none;}


.daohang_list1{width:296px; background:#f5f5f5; border:1px solid #dcdcdc;}
.daohang_list1 h3{text-align:center; padding-left:0; color:#3e3e3e; font-size:14px; font-weight:normal;}
.daohang2{position:relative;}
.daohang2 .daohang_list1{display:none}
.daohang2:hover .daohang_list1{display:block}
.daohang_list1{position:absolute; z-index:111; top:36px; left:0;}
.zdh1{border-top:1px dashed #d9d9d9;}
.zdh1 h3{font-size:14px; color:#3e3e3e !important; font-weight:normal; line-height:20px; padding:7px 0;}
.zdh1:hover h3{font-size:14px; color:#3e3e3e; font-weight:bold; line-height:20px;}
.zdh1 a:hover{ text-decoration:none;}

/*内页右侧*/

.page_RightMain{width:900px; margin:auto; margin-top:20px; padding-bottom:50px;}


.in_asd{width:375px; float:left; overflow:hidden; position:relative; margin-bottom:20px;}
.in_img{width:375px; height:244px; overflow:hidden; position:relative;}
.in_img img{width:373px; height:242px; display:block; border:1px solid #e2e2e2;}
.in_proname {width:345px;}
.in_proname a{color:#000000; font-size:15px; line-height:20px; font-weight:normal;}
.in_asd .in_rsp{width:375px;height:244px;overflow:hidden;position: absolute; background:url(../img/pro_bg.png) no-repeat; top:0px;left:0px; z-index:111; cursor:pointer;}
.in_asd .in_text{position:absolute;width:375px;height:142px;left:-375px;top:102px;overflow:hidden; text-align:center; z-index:111;}

.pro_more{width:120px; height:35px; margin:auto; background:#000; text-align:center; line-height:35px;}
.pro_more a{ font-size:14px; color:#ffffff;}



/*通用样式*/
#product_detail { width:100%; margin-top:25px;}
#product_detail .left { width: 344px;float:left;}
#product_detail .big_pic { width: 344px; height:245px; text-align:center;border: 1px solid #419019}
#product_detail .big_pic img {width:342px;}
#product_detail .big_pic .bigimg{ width:700px; height:497px;}
#product_detail .big_pic .view { display: block;text-indent: 20px; margin-left: 130px; width: 19px; height: 15px; display: inline-block; cursor: pointer; }
#product_name{ font-size:20px !important; color:#333333 !important; font-weight:normal; line-height:25px;}
.pro_info_box { width:500px; height:153px; text-align:left;}
.pro_info_box h4{ display:inline-block;font-size:27px; color:#000; line-height:40px; font-weight:bold; padding-bottom:15px}
.pro_info_box span{font-size:16px; color:#000000;}
#product_detail .product_info {width:500px; float:right; overflow:hidden;}
#product_detail .product_info li {line-height:22px;font-size:15px; color:#333333;}
#product_detail .product_info li span{ font-size:15px; color:#333333;}


/*焦点图*/
#product_detail ul.pic_list {width:485px; overflow: hidden; height:140px;}
#product_detail ul.pic_list li { width:137px; height: 95px; text-align:center;float:left;}
#product_detail ul li { list-style: none; }

.mod18{width:100%;height:95px; position:relative;}
.mod18 .btn{position:absolute;width:26px;height:137px; cursor:pointer;z-index:99;}
.mod18 .prev{top:0px;background:url(../img/l_btn.jpg) no-repeat;left:0px;}

.mod18 .next{top:0px;background:url(../img/r_btn.jpg) no-repeat;right:0px;}


.mod18 .listBox{width:411px;height:95px;position:relative;overflow:hidden;margin: auto;}
.mod18 .listBox ul{height:95px;position:absolute;}
.mod18 .listBox li{cursor:pointer;position:relative;}
.mod18 .listBox li i{display:none;}
.mod18 .listBox li img{width:129px;border: 1px solid #419019}

.mod18 .listBox .on i{display:block;}

.bt{
background: #419019;
color: #ffffff;
border: 0 !important;
cursor: pointer;
height: 35px !important;
padding: 0 10px 0 10px !important;
width:69px !important;

}

.in_case{width:1190px; float:left; margin-bottom:22px;height: 220px;background: #fff;border:1px solid #eee;}
.in_case:hover{box-shadow: 4px 4px 5px #999}
.incase_pic{width:375px; height:220px; overflow:hidden;float: right;}
.incase_pic img{width:375px; height:220px;}
.incase_name{width:620px; float: left; padding:30px;}
.incase_name a{font-size:14px; color:#000;}
.incase_name li{clear: both;}

.detailtitle{width:1190px; margin:auto; background:url(../img/in_right.jpg) right center no-repeat; line-height:50px; font-size:22px; color:#333333; text-align:left; text-transform:uppercase; font-weight:bold;}
.detailtitle2{width:100%; text-align:center; background:url(../img/in_titledot2.jpg) center bottom no-repeat; height:45px; line-height:40px; font-size:22px; color:#fefefe; font-weight:bold; text-transform:uppercase;}
#pro_profile{ width:100%; padding-top:20px; overflow-x:auto;}
#pro_profile table{width:100%;}
#pro_profile table td{ padding-left:5px;}
.btn ul li{ float:left !important;}

.pro_title1{ width:100%; font-size:22px; color:#00366e; line-height:49px; border-bottom:5px solid #002c6f}
.back{ width:100%; padding:15px 0; text-align:center}
.back span{ padding:5px 15px; color:#fff; background:#0f83d8; font-size:14px;}

.page_inquirybg{ width:100%; margin:0 auto; min-width:1002px; max-width:1920px; padding-bottom:37px; background:#f1f1f1; margin-bottom:30px; padding-top:28px;}

.pro_title2{width:700px;padding-left:11px;text-align:left;line-height:42px; font-size:22px; color:#004d98; background:#efefef; font-weight:bold; text-transform:uppercase; float:left;}

.proinquiry{width:100%; padding:10px 0 0 0}



.right{ float:right}
.news #news_detail .body{ width:100%; float:left;}
.news #news_detail{ width:100%; float:left; padding:10px 0}
.news #news_detail h1{ text-align:center; font-size:18px;}
.prev_next{padding-bottom:20px; width:100%; float:left;}
.prev_next ul li{ list-style:none}

.news_view{ width:100%; float:left; padding:5px 0; border-bottom:1px dashed #ccc}

.back input[type=button]{ background:#ff9c00; padding:3px 10px; border:0; color:#fff; cursor:pointer; font-size:16px; font-family:Arial}
.news_body{ padding:10px 0}

.main_page{text-align:center;width:100%; float:left; padding-top:15px; padding-bottom:30px;}
.main_page a,.main_page .current{ margin:0 5px;}
.main_page a{ background:#f5f5f5; padding:3px 8px; color:#717071 !important; border:1px solid #d6d7d2}
.main_page .current{ padding:3px 8px; background:#0b72a9; color:#fff;border:1px solid #0b72a9}

#sitemap ul li{ list-style:none; text-align:left; list-style:none}
#sitemap ul li h2{ font-size:16px; padding-bottom:8px;color:#333333; text-transform:uppercase; font-weight:normal;}
#sitemap ul li ul li{ float:inherit; padding-left:30px}
#sitemap ul li ul li h3,#sitemap ul li ul li a{ font-size:14px;line-height:24px; color:#333333; font-weight:normal;}

/*关联产品与新闻*/
.reation{ width:100%; float:left; padding-top:15px;}
.reation h5{ font-size:24px; border-bottom:1px solid #ccc; line-height:38px; margin-bottom:10px;}

/*评论*/
.inquiry{ width:100%; float:left;}
.comment{ width:100%; float:left; padding:10px 0}
.commentTitle{ width:100%; float:left; text-align:left;}
.commentTitle h5{ font-size:22px; color:#333333; line-height:53px;text-align:left; font-weight:normal}
.commentTitle h5 span{ float:right; line-height:53px; font-size:14px;}
.commentTitle h5 span a{color:#333333;}
.commentlist{ width:100%; float:left; padding-top:10px; text-align:left;}
.commentlist ul{ width:100%; float:left;}
.commentlist ul li{ float:left; list-style:none}
.inquiryinfo{ width:100%; float:left; padding-bottom:10px;}

.left_title{background: url(../img/leftbg.jpg) no-repeat;width: 280px;height: 105px;line-height: 110px;text-transform: uppercase;}
.left_title2{background: url(../img/leftbg2.jpg) no-repeat;width: 210px;height: 71px;line-height: 82px;color: #fff;font-size: 28px;text-transform: uppercase;padding-left: 55px;}
.left_title3{
    background: url(../img/leftbg.jpg) no-repeat;
    width: 180px;
    padding-left: 50px;
    padding-right: 41px;
    padding-top: 23px;
    height: 55px;
    line-height: 23px;
    text-align: left;
    color: #fff;
    font-size: 17px;
    text-transform: uppercase;
}

.left_con{background: #fff;box-shadow: 0px 5px 5px #ebebeb;
    padding-bottom: 20px;}
.yiji{width: 227px;margin: 15px auto;background: #404040;padding-left: 11px;}
.yiji a h3{line-height: 24px;font-size: 16px;color: #fff;font-weight: normal;    padding: 5px 0px;}
.yiji:hover{background: #009fa8}
.yijion{width: 227px;margin: 15px auto;background: #009fa8;padding-left: 11px;}
.yijion a h3{line-height: 24px;font-size: 16px;color: #fff;font-weight: normal;    padding: 5px 0px;}

.erji:first-child{padding-top:0px}
.erji{ width: 225px;padding-left: 30px;line-height: 20px;padding-top:17px;padding-bottom: 10px;border-bottom:1px solid #efefef;clear: both; }
.erji a h3{font-size: 16px;color: #333333;font-weight: normal;}
.erji:hover a h3{color: #68c1b1;font-weight: normal;}
.erji:hover{width: 225px;padding-left: 30px;
    padding-bottom: 10px;line-height: 20px;}
.erjion a h3{color: #68c1b1;font-weight: bold;}

.erjion{ width: 225px;padding-left: 30px;clear: both;
    padding-bottom: 10px;line-height: 20px; }


.asd2{width:255px; float:left; overflow:hidden; position:relative;height: 221px;border:1px solid #d2d2d2;}
.img2{width:255px; overflow:hidden; position:relative;}
.img2 img{width:255px;height: 220px; display:block;cursor: pointer;
       transition: all 0.6s;}
.asd2:hover .img2 img{transform: scale(1.2);}       
.in_proname2 {width:235px; padding:10px;background: #000;text-align: center;position: absolute;bottom: 0px;left: 0px;opacity: 0.7}

.in_proname2 a{color:#fff; font-size:18px; line-height:24px; font-weight:normal;}


.detail_title ul li {
    width: 250px;
    height: 34px;
    padding-left: 15px;
    margin: auto;
    background: url(../img/in_titledot2.jpg) no-repeat;
    text-align: left;
    font-size: 18px;
    color: #fff;
    line-height: 34px;
    float: left;
    text-transform: uppercase;
}
.detail_title{border-bottom: 1px solid #ccc;clear: both;height: 33px;}

.detail_title ul li:hover{
	background: url(../img/in_titledot3.jpg) no-repeat;
	color: #fff
}  
.pro_detail{text-align: left;padding: 20px 0px;}

.page_ClassList:hover .mz{
    background: #404040;
}
.page_ClassList:hover .mz a h3{
	color: #fff
}
.classpic a img{width: 280px; cursor: pointer;
    transition: all 1s;}
.classpic a img:hover{
	transform: scale(1.2);
}
.classpic{
	width: 280px;height: 181px;border:1px solid #cccccc;overflow: hidden;   
}
.page_ClassList{width: 282px;
    float: left;
    overflow: hidden;
    background: #fff;
    
    }
.mz{    width: 262px;
    padding: 10px;
    background: #fff;}   

.mz a h3{
    color: #666;
    font-size: 15px;
    line-height: 20px;
    font-weight: normal;
} 
.product_image a img{width: 270px;height: 180px;}
.show_product_list ul li{width: 270px;float: left;}


.in_list{width: 100%;height: 75px;border-bottom: 1px solid #e5e5e5;background: #ffffff}
.prolist_in{height: 82px;width: 1190px;margin: auto;position: relative;z-index: 5}
.prolist_in li{float: left;}
.prolist_in li h3{line-height: 75px;font-family: 'helvetica_condensed';padding: 0px 70px;font-weight: normal;}

.child2 ul li{padding-left: 50px;padding-top: 10px;padding-bottom: 10px;background: url(../img/list3.png) 32px center no-repeat;}
.child2 ul li h3{font-size: 14px;color: #666;line-height: 20px;font-weight: normal;}
.child2 ul li:hover h3{color: #68c1b1}
.child2 ul li:hover{background: url(../img/list3on.png) 32px center no-repeat;}

.right_time{float: right;line-height: 30px;}

.body li a:hover{color: #66bfb1}

.page_pro{ width:278px; float:left;position: relative;overflow: hidden;border: 1px solid #333333}
.pro_name{width: 278px;height: 50px;background:#333;text-align: center;padding-top: 3px;}
.pro_name a{font-size: 16px;color: #ffffff;}

.page_pro img{width:278px;cursor: pointer;transition: all 0.8s;}
.page_pro:hover img{transform: scale(1.2);}



.page_pro:hover {border: 1px solid #419019}
.page_pro:hover .pro_name{background:#419019;}

.page_name{width: 365px;position: relative;text-align: center;margin-top: -7px;padding-bottom: 30px;background: #fff}
.page_name a{font-size: 19px;line-height:30px;padding-left: 15px;}
.page_name2 a{text-align: center;font-size: 30px;color: #333333}
.page_descr{width: 350px;margin: auto;margin-top: 25px;font-size: 18px;color: #535353;line-height: 26px;}
.page_more{width: 210px;height: 34px;background: #0b72a9;margin: auto;margin-top: 30px;border-radius: 5px;text-align: center;}
.page_more a{line-height: 34px;color: #fff;font-size: 22px;text-transform: uppercase;}

.Page_Search{padding-top: 20px;}